Ask the experts and your peers at The Register Security Debate, September 24 2008. Nearly half (45.2 per cent) of all internet surfers neglect to regularly update their browser software. Slackness in applying updates in a timely fashion leaves an estimated 637 million surfers vulnerable to drive-by download attacks, according to a new survey. Figures in the survey come from a study of user-agent data collected by Google’s web search and application servers and analyzed by security researchers from IBM's ISS security division, Google and ETH Zurich University. The study found that Firefox users were the most diligent in applying security updates, with 83.3 per cent using the latest version. Less than... [read full story]
